Well Project DD is nearing completion and has been in regular use over the summer. Snagging list was very long, but they have being getting picked off slowly but surely. Have fitted some R888s on the front and some Ferodo DS pads to make it a bit more fade resistant and track day friendly.

Final Spec as follows

Espace 2.9i engine
3 branch exhaust manifolds
Custom exhaust and induction systems
New ancillaries
Turbo fuel system
New radiator
New discs and ferodo DS pads
GAZ Coilovers all round
AZEV 'M's 7x17 & 8.5x17
Repainted Ford Moondust silver

Finally getting round to sorting out the last few bits on project DD . Have had the inlet manifold and fuel rails vapour blasted , rocker covers and plenum shotblasted and powder coated. Fuel injectors cleaned and flowed, new induction kit ready to go on, new alternator and belts, plugs and oil. Just a couple of electrical issues to sort after that and it will be finished. May go back to standard wheels too if I can sell my AZEVs.

Been chipping away with an hour here and there of fitting the new shiny bits, painting brackets, looming wiring, polishing bolts etc. Rerouted the induction to the other side so I can cool the alternator and starter motor better. Made up an induction kit from an old GTA Turbo air box pipe and a Viper induction kit I had spare. I think its come out pretty well, and should feed efficiently. Its not until you look at before and after pics that you can see how much improvement there is!
